"Pirates of the Caribbean: The Visual Guide" by Richard Platt offers an in-depth exploration of the swashbuckling world made famous by the film series. This illustrated guide features detailed information about the characters, ships, and settings that bring the high seas to life. Readers are introduced to iconic figures like Captain Jack Sparrow and Captain Barbossa, as well as the perilous adventures they embark on. Through vibrant illustrations and intricate descriptions, the book immerses fans in the lore of piracy, uncovering hidden treasures, secrets of the Caribbean, and the mysterious supernatural elements that define the series' thrilling narrative.
